The new base metals incubator launched at Zincor late in 2008 is the first in its industry. Lepharo will identify candidates for training as entrepreneurs in making marketable products from zinc, copper and brass.
Lepharo will produce rainwater goods, expanded zinc anodes, galvanized roofing products and zinc cast products. Candidates are being recruited primarily from disadvantaged groups, although the incubator is open to all. The project is a partnership between Exxaro, Impala Platinum Refineries, Ekurhuleni Metropolitan Municipality and the South African Enterprise Development Agency (SEDA) Technology Centre. It is also being actively supported by the industry bodies for zinc and copper.
Following years of planning, research into target markets and course development, the first 12 candidates began their studies last year. |
